Cylindrical lithium batteries are classified into different systems, including lithium iron phosphate, lithium cobalt oxide, lithium manganese oxide, cobalt-manganese hybrid, and ternary materials. To make a 48V battery system, you need to connect four 12V batteries in series. Wiring in series means connecting the positive terminal of one battery to the negative terminal of the next, so the voltages add up, producing a combined voltage of 48V from four 12V units. . Creating a 48V system from 12V batteries is essential for many applications, such as residential solar energy systems and electric vehicle, offering improved efficiency, reduced current loss, and greater compatibility. This configuration adds voltages while maintaining the same ampere-hour (Ah) capacity. While it's technically possible, there are important trade-offs to consider.
